DAMAGE EVALUATION METHOD OF HEAT-RESISTANT STEEL, AND DAMAGE EVALUATION DEVICE THEREOF

机译:耐热钢的损伤评估方法及其损伤评估装置

摘要

PROBLEM TO BE SOLVED: To provide a damage evaluation method for heat-resistant steel capable of precisely evaluating the creep remaining lifetime assessment, even in relation to heat-resistant steel having long-time durability, such as austenite type stainless steel.;SOLUTION: The heat-resistant steel being an inspection target is corroded, to form corrosion pits on the surface of the heat-resistant steel and pit number density being the number of the corrosion pits per unit area is detected, while the relation diagram of the creep remaining lifetime consumption ratio, showing the future lifetime up to the destruction of the heat-resistant steel and the pit number density is prepared, and the creep future lifetime of the heat-resistant steel is calculated from the relation diagram, on the basis of the detection value of the pit number density.;COPYRIGHT: (C)2008,JPO&INPIT
